Generatorexit python
WebApr 14, 2024 · This function allows you to record every keystroke made by the user and store it in a file named a.txt in the same folder. The function uses Python's built-in logging module to log information about the keystrokes and any errors that may occur. The function first checks if the file already exists and creates it if it doesn't. It then enters a ... WebMar 1, 2011 · Т.к. Python трактует перенос строки как разделитель выражений, и т.к. выражения очень часто не вмещаются в одну строку, многие люди поступают вот так: ... и «GeneratorExit» (которые по сути не являются ...
Generatorexit python
Did you know?
Web""" try: self.throw(GeneratorExit) except (GeneratorExit, StopIteration): pass else: raise RuntimeError("generator ignored GeneratorExit") Note that I copied close directly from … WebDec 1, 2024 · In Python, generators are functions that construct iterators. When the generator wants to return a result, it uses the same syntax as a function, but instead of using return, we use yield. With a few more methods and slight variations in yield statements, coroutines vary from Python’s generators.
WebMay 17, 2024 · 我们拼错了内置的 print () 函数以引发 NameError 异常。 修复此异常的唯一方法是查找 Python 的官方文档以获取正确的函数定义。 使用了未定义的变量或函数 这是引发 NameError 异常的另一个常见原因。 我们倾向于调用不存在的函数或变量。 此代码片段演示了一个内置函数在调用时拼写错误的场景,这会引发 NameError 异常。 print(value) … WebDec 7, 2024 · python怎么生成应用程序错误_python 生成器的GeneratorExit异常. 当一个生成器对象被销毁时,会抛出一个GeneratorExit异常。. 请看下面的代码。. 当调用next方法时,会激活生成器,直至遇到生成器方法的yield语句,返回值1。. 同时,生成器方法被挂起。. 然后打印1,此时 ...
WebProduct: Core Core Shared components used by Firefox and other Mozilla software, including handling of Web content; Gecko, HTML, CSS, layout, DOM, scripts, images, networking, etc. Issues with web page layout probably go here, while Firefox user interface issues belong in the Firefoxproduct. (More info) WebPython GeneratorExit is an exception that is raised in generators when they are closed. In this tutorial, we will explore how the GeneratorExit exception works and we will go …
WebMar 19, 2024 · Released: Mar 19, 2024 Project description PyObfuscator Description This tool obfuscates python code. Requirements This package require : python3.9 or greater python3.9 or greater Standard Library Installation pip …
WebPython GeneratorExit GeneratorExit is an exception that is raised to terminate a generator or a generator-based coroutine. When a GeneratorExit exception is raised … my keyboard is going crazyWebFeb 9, 2024 · generator.close() raise a GeneratorExit exception; GeneratorExit is catched by except Exception as e: and loop continues; value = (yield value) executes; according … my keyboard hot key functionsWebMar 14, 2024 · A GeneratorExit exception is raised when a generator or coroutine is closed. Example : def my_generator (): try: for i in range(5): print ('Yielding', i) yield i except GeneratorExit: print ('Exiting early') g = my_generator () print (g.next()) g.close () Output : Yielding 0 0 Exiting early exception ImportError my keyboard highlights lettersWebMar 31, 2024 · In Python, all the Exceptions derive from the class called BaseException. Below BaseException all the built-in exceptions are arranged as a hierarchy. The main four subclasses under … my keyboard is clicking when i typeWebPython 生成器类的实例(递归),python,recursion,generator,Python,Recursion,Generator. ... 在生成器上调用close时,它会在当前暂停执行的点上引发GeneratorExit。在重新引发异常之前,您可以捕获该异常并在except块中进行清理(不允许忽略它) 对于递归生成器来说,这有点复杂 ... my keyboard home button not workingmy keyboard is frozenWebIssue 30083: Asyncio: GeneratorExit + strange exception - Python tracker Issue30083 This issue tracker has been migrated to GitHub , and is currently read-only. For more … old fashioned cake doughnut